    This video by Baron Soosdon is described on its YouTube page as "not machinima." Of course, the good Baron has the right to say that about any of his work he'd like, but this is still one hell of a gorgeous video. The video is called Depth of Field Wonderland and was created to test out Malu05's machinima tool. The big deal about Malu05's tool is that it allows machinima creators to introduce depth of field to their creations. Depth of field in photography refers to the areas in front of and behind a subject being in varying degrees of focus. By manipulating depth of field, machinimators like Baron Soosdon can create visual excitement and focus in their work. The Baron's work is always outstanding and beautiful. Depth of Field Wonderland shows off both the Baron's talent for visuals and imagery as well as the power of Malu05's tool. Interested in the wide world of machinima?     (The tool that we are featuring today is a hack for machinima only. Using it could get your account banned by Blizzard. When it is released, use it at your own risk.)One of the highlights of being part of the machinima community is being surrounded by all of these brilliant minds, scripting, creating, and figuring out ways around obstacles in their chosen platform. Mads Lund, better known as Malu05, is currently developing a tool that will literally change the way World of Warcraft machinima is produced.While it is still in alpha testing, it can already zoom, auto-pan in multiple directions, change the size of your avatar, adjust the speed of your movement, time of day, and speed up how the day progresses, detach your camera in spectator mode, and set camera motions that you can go back to. If you're anxious to speed up the production, he is calling for participation in the AutoIt forum.     In January 2006, a group of friends, including Dopefish and Malu05, decided to create a community machinima project, Nogg-aholic Collaboration, or NAC, to showcase World of Warcraft in ways that they felt had not been done before. Named after the time period in which it was filmed, February 2006, My Burning Valentine was intended to highlight what NAC was all about, as well as its guidelines. However, the more that they explored the depths of their creativity, the less that they wanted to show off this film!As they continued to add to the guidelines for NAC, the release date was being pushed farther back. In the end, their interest waned, so they closed down the forum and moved on, leaving this video behind as a memory.
